Placing the Speakers (BDS 600 System)

Placing the Front Left and Front Right Speakers

If your TV is placed on a table, you can place the soundbar on the table directly in front of the
TV, centered with the TV screen. Attach the supplied rubber feet to the soundbar as shown in
the illustration.

If your TV is located in an entertainment or media center, you can mount the soundbar in a
space directly above or below the TV.

WARNING: Do NOT place the soundbar directly on top of a TV or at the front
edge of a table or cabinet. It could roll forward and injure someone.

Wall-Mounting the Soundbar

If your TV is attached to a wall, you can use the included wall-mount brackets to mount the
soundbar on the wall directly below the TV screen.

Determine the location for the soundbar on the wall. Make sure that the top of the

1.

soundbar will not block your view of the TV screen when it is mounted on the wall.

Mark the locations of the soundbar wall-mount bracket holes on the wall. The holes for

2.

the left and right brackets are spaced 600mm apart. The top and bottom holes for each
bracket are spaced 25mm apart. See the illustration below.

NOTE: To insure that the soundbar will be level, use a carpenter’s level, a laser sight or another
device to insure that the two sets of holes are at exactly the same height.

Attach the two wall-mount brackets to the wall at the locations you marked, using

3.

hardware that is appropriate for the wall’s construction and materials. Note that the
soundbar weighs 8.1 lb (3.67kg). Be sure to use hardware that can support this weight.

Mounting Options for Satellite and Center Speakers

Shelf Placement

You can place the satellite and center speakers on shelves. BDS 800 and BDS 400 satellite
speakers have built-in bases for shelf placement. If you want, you can remove a base by
pulling it straight off its speaker. Apply even pressure to both sides of the base and smoothly
slide it off the speaker.

Wall-Mounting the BDS 800 and BDS 400 Satellite Speakers

IMPORTANT: Read the Connections section, on page 14, before wall-mounting the satellite
speakers. You will need to insert the speaker wires through the wall-mount brackets and
connect the wires to the speakers during the process of installing the brackets.

NOTE: If you are using your own speaker wire, it must be no thicker than the wire supplied
with the speakers. Thicker wire will prevent the wall-mount bracket from sliding onto the
speaker.
